PostgreSQL Development Group เพิ่งเปิดตัว PostgreSQL 16 รุ่นเบต้า ซึ่งเป็นการอัปเดตครั้งใหญ่ที่กำลังจะมีขึ้นสำหรับฐานข้อมูลเชิงสัมพันธ์แบบโอเพ่นซอร์สที่ใช้กันอย่างแพร่หลาย รุ่นนี้แสดงให้เห็นถึงการปรับปรุงที่สำคัญในการดำเนินการค้นหา การจำลองแบบลอจิคัล ประสบการณ์ของนักพัฒนา และความปลอดภัย ผู้ใช้ที่ต้องการเข้าร่วมการทดสอบเบต้าของ PostgreSQL 16 Beta 1 สามารถดาวน์โหลดเวอร์ชันนี้ได้จากเว็บไซต์ทางการของโครงการ
มีการปรับปรุงมากมายเพื่อเพิ่มประสิทธิภาพโดยรวม เวอร์ชันที่อัปเดตเน้นการสืบค้นแบบขนานขั้นสูง ซึ่งเปิดใช้งานการดำเนินการแบบขนานของการรวม FULL และ RIGHT ตลอดจนการดำเนินการแบบขนานของฟังก์ชันการรวม string_agg และ array_agg นอกจากนี้ PostgreSQL 16 ยังรวมการเรียงลำดับที่เพิ่มขึ้นในการค้นหา SELECT DISTINCT และเพิ่มประสิทธิภาพการโหลดข้อมูลจำนวนมากพร้อมกันโดยใช้ COPY สูงถึง 300%
โดยเฉพาะอย่างยิ่ง PostgreSQL 16 แนะนำการรองรับการเร่ง CPU โดยใช้ SIMD (คำสั่งเดียว ข้อมูลหลายรายการ) สำหรับทั้งสถาปัตยกรรม x86 และ Arm ประกอบด้วยการปรับให้เหมาะสมสำหรับการประมวลผลสตริง ASCII และ JSON และการค้นหาอาร์เรย์และธุรกรรมย่อย นอกจากนี้ การจัดสรรภาระงานยังพร้อมใช้งานสำหรับ libpq ซึ่งเป็นไลบรารีไคลเอ็นต์ PostgreSQL คุณลักษณะการจำลองแบบเชิงตรรกะได้รับการเปลี่ยนแปลงเช่นกัน PostgreSQL 16 ช่วยให้สามารถถอดรหัสเชิงตรรกะบนอินสแตนซ์สแตนด์บายได้แล้ว โดยนำเสนอตัวเลือกที่หลากหลายมากขึ้นสำหรับการกระจายภาระงาน
ประสิทธิภาพของการจำลองแบบเชิงลอจิคัลได้รับการปรับปรุงอย่างมาก ทำให้มั่นใจได้ถึงการสตรีมข้อมูลแบบเรียลไทม์อย่างมีประสิทธิภาพไปยังอินสแตนซ์ PostgreSQL อื่นๆ หรือระบบภายนอกที่เข้ากันได้กับโปรโตคอลโลจิคัล สำหรับนักพัฒนา รุ่นใหม่ยังคงใช้มาตรฐาน SQL/JSON สำหรับการจัดการข้อมูล JSON ประกอบด้วยการสนับสนุนตัวสร้าง SQL/JSON, ฟังก์ชันรวม ANY_VALUE มาตรฐานใหม่ของ SQL และจำนวนเต็มที่ไม่ใช่ทศนิยม เช่น 0xff และ 0o777
นอกจากนี้ยังมีการเพิ่มการสนับสนุนโปรโตคอลการสืบค้นเพิ่มเติมในไคลเอนต์ psql รุ่นเบต้าเหล่านี้จะช่วยผู้ใช้ในการทดสอบความทนทานและความน่าเชื่อถือของ PostgreSQL 16 ก่อนการเปิดตัวอย่างเป็นทางการในช่วงปลายปี 2566 แพลตฟอร์มที่รองรับ ได้แก่ ระบบปฏิบัติการ Linux, Windows, macOS, BSD และ Solaris
องค์กรที่กำลังมองหาแพลตฟอร์ม no-code ที่สามารถทำงานกับ ฐานข้อมูลที่เข้ากันได้กับ PostgreSQL ควรพิจารณา AppMaster.io ซึ่งเป็นแพลตฟอร์มการพัฒนาแอปพลิเคชัน no-code ที่ทรงพลัง หลากหลาย และเป็นมิตรกับผู้ใช้ ด้วยความสามารถที่เป็นนวัตกรรมใหม่ เช่น ตัวออกแบบ Visual BP ของ AppMaster, REST API และ WSS Endpoints ผู้ใช้สามารถเร่งการพัฒนาแบ็กเอนด์ เว็บ และแอปพลิเคชั่นมือถือได้อย่างรวดเร็วด้วยการเข้ารหัสที่น้อยที่สุดและไม่มีภาระทางเทคนิค แพลตฟอร์มของ AppMaster.io ได้รับการเสนอชื่อให้เป็น High Performance and Momentum Leader in No-Code Development Platforms โดย G2 ในฤดูใบไม้ผลิปี 2023 และฤดูหนาวปี 2023